Gothic Quarter Discovery and Gastronomic Delights

Morning
Start your day with a traditional Catalan breakfast at Can Culleretes, the oldest restaurant in Barcelona, located in the heart of the Gothic Quarter. After breakfast, take a leisurely stroll through the charming streets of the Gothic Quarter (Barri Gotic) and visit the iconic Barcelona Cathedral (Catedral de Barcelona).
Afternoon
For lunch, savor authentic tapas at Cervecería Catalana, a local favorite known for its bustling atmosphere and delicious small plates. Afterward, explore the vibrant La Boqueria Market (Mercat de la Boqueria) and indulge in some of the freshest produce and local delicacies.
Evening
In the evening, enjoy a memorable dining experience at El Nacional, a stunning food hall that offers a variety of culinary options. After dinner, take a leisurely walk down Las Ramblas and soak in the lively atmosphere of this famous street.

Modernist Marvels and Artistic Inspirations

Morning
Begin your day with a visit to the iconic Sagrada Familia. Be sure to book your tickets in advance to skip the line and enjoy a guided tour of Gaudí's masterpiece. After exploring the Sagrada Familia, take a short walk to Brunch & Cake for a delightful brunch experience in a charming setting.
Afternoon
After brunch, continue your Gaudí trail with a visit to Casa Batlló and Milà House (Casa Milà). Explore the unique architecture and learn about the life and work of this visionary artist. For a late afternoon pick-me-up, enjoy a cup of coffee at Tickets, a Michelin-starred restaurant known for its innovative cuisine and playful atmosphere.
Evening
For dinner, indulge in a gastronomic feast at ABaC Restaurant, a three-Michelin-starred restaurant that offers a truly unforgettable dining experience. After dinner, take a leisurely evening stroll through the Eixample district and admire the beautiful modernist buildings that define the city's architectural landscape.

Montjuïc Magic and Seafront Serenity

Morning
Spend the morning exploring the Montjuïc area, starting with a ride on the Montjuïc Cable Car for panoramic views of the city. Visit the Montjuic Castle (Castell de Montjuïc) and take a leisurely walk through the Montjuïc Park (Parc de Montjuïc) .
Afternoon
For a memorable lunch with a view, head to Makamaka Beach Burger Cafe on Barceloneta Beach . After lunch, take a relaxing stroll along the beach or enjoy a refreshing swim in the Mediterranean Sea.
Evening
End your last evening in Barcelona with a magical sunset at the Magic Fountain (Font Màgica). Afterward, savor a final dinner at Disfrutar, a Michelin-starred restaurant that offers a creative and contemporary take on Mediterranean cuisine.
